Key Considerations & Measures
Principals& Contradictions Tax environment (individual, corporate) Identification of Stakeholders that are close to your org, mission. What
happens when you throw a stone into the sea? Have you written your story , impact and planned achievements? Do you have our B/S and Income Statement? Audited? Budget? Diversity of Sources: Long-term Strategic Sponsors, Short term, Non-profit,
public, private (individual, corporate, family foundations), online, international organizations, various products and organizations that you may create fund from sale of products& services such as a sale of a card, magazine, second hand stores, etc.
Sustainability. Can we repeat this fundraising event/product every year? Conference, product fairs, Gala dinners, Races..?
Can you get in-kind of donations? Don’t forget to keep the statistics. How many volunteers will be involved? What are the costs involved? Can we attain %8 GA expenses? When you mature what are other financial tools you may consider?. Legacies&
bequests, endowment, operating reserves.

Renovation of 35 libraries in three years. 35,000 persons participated in activities, talks, shows, films, exhibitions. 400 volunteers from nearby universities.
Peking Paris Classical Automobile Race
Raised more than $ 300,000 for scholarships
Our main sponsor donated $100,000 received $2,500,000 worth of media coverage. 15 Volunteers.
Organizations
www.adım.adim.orgStarted first at 2008 with 50,000 euros to 250,000 in one event in Antalya in 2012.Founders are still active 2 women in their 30’s. 1000 runners collected money from 19,000 donors.
Togbazaar event 2000 visitor. Total income from entrance and stant sale is 200,000 euros. 25 women working for 3 months.
Collection of money at funerals and happy days instead of giving flowers (27,000 events of 8.2 million net of TL 5.65 million in 2011)
TEV gave scholarships of 182,ooo students in Turkey and
1359 students abroad.
